Double Olympic champion in biathlon Dmitry Vasiliev in a conversation with , he expressed the opinion that the Russian biathlete Edward Latypov is now more efficient than the world champion Anton Shipulin during his career.
On Sunday, Latypov won the men’s mass start at the sixth round of the PARI Commonwealth Cup in Tyumen, scoring his sixth consecutive victory in this competition. He covered the distance in 36 minutes and 26.3 seconds, with three misses on four firing ranges.
The second was the Russian Roman Eremin, who lost 11.3 seconds (two misses) to the winner, the third was the Belarusian Nikita Lobastov (+17.4, one miss).

– Latypov has always run very well, now he shoots better from time to time, so in many races he has a big lead over his rivals. To perform at world level and compete with the steroid Norwegians, you have to shoot well. In a year we should probably be back, by which time we have to be ready to zero on the turn. Of course Latypov is great, he is very stable, he has won six important races in a row. I don’t remember anyone in Russia showing such stability.
“Shipulin?”
– Even from Shipulin, I don’t remember such stability on so many races. It is clear that during his performances the emphasis was on international performances, but after all, Latypov wins important races, Vasiliev told .
Three-time Olympic bronze medalist Latypov previously won the overall Commonwealth Cup ahead of schedule.
